In 2006, the General Equal Treatment Act (AGG) came into force. This study examines the effects of the AGG and the newly introduced discrimination prohibitions on occupational pension law. The author first reviews various provisions that were previously common in occupational pension law to determine whether they may have become unlawful due to the new discrimination prohibitions. Subsequently, he analyzes the implications of the finding that a provision that was permissible until 2006 may no longer be compliant with the law.
